What is an Electric Incline Treadmill ? An electric incline treadmill enables users to change the angle of the running surface at the touch of a button, replicating the experience of running or walking uphill. This feature not only diversifies workouts but also substantially increases the intensity, therefore enhancing cardiovascular physical fitness and calorie expense.
Table 1: Key Features of Electric Incline Treadmills Function Description Incline Range Normally from 0% to 15% or even higher Motor Power Varies by model (normally 2.0 to 4.0 HP) Speed Settings Adjustable speeds normally varying from 0.5 to 12 mph Show Console LCD screens providing speed, range, time, and heart rate Built-in Programs Pre-set exercises for diverse training and HIIT Weight Capacity Usually supports users up to 300 lbs or more Folding Mechanism Numerous designs use space-saving designs Advantages of Using a Treadmill with Electric Incline 1. Boosted Caloric Burn Among the most substantial benefits of including an incline into your treadmill workout is the increased calorie burn. Research studies suggest that walking or working on an incline can raise calorie expense by approximately 50% compared to exercising on a flat surface area. This is specifically useful for those intending to reduce weight or enhance their overall fitness levels.
2. Improved Cardiovascular Health Regular exercises on an incline treadmill can improve cardiovascular health. The included resistance forces the heart to pump more blood, improving total cardiovascular efficiency. This adaptation can lead to much better endurance throughout both aerobic and anaerobic activities.
3. Strengthening of Muscles Using an incline engages different muscle groups compared to conventional flat running. The primary muscles targeted consist of the glutes, hamstrings, calves, and even the core. This strengthened musculature not only adds to enhanced performance in running however likewise helps in daily activities.
4. Joint-Friendly Workouts For individuals with joint concerns, a treadmill with incline permits a tailored workout experience. Walking at an incline minimizes the influence on joints by allowing users to vary the strength without the harshness related to working on a flat surface area.
5. Variety and Motivation Monotony can cause workout plateaus and reduced inspiration. Electric incline treadmills use a wide variety of incline settings and exercise programs, keeping regimens fresh and engaging. This range helps maintain inspiration and motivates constant exercise practices.

The incline feature of a treadmill changes the angle of the running deck utilizing an electric motor, enabling users to raise or reduce the incline quickly by means of controls on the console.
Q2: Is working on an incline bad for my knees? Working on an incline can in fact be simpler on your knees compared to running on a flat surface area, as it lowers the influence on the joints. However, it's vital to listen to your body and change the incline according to your physical fitness level.
Q3: Can I truly burn more calories operating on an incline? Yes! Research studies have shown that running or walking on an incline can significantly increase caloric burn, with some reports suggesting that incline exercises can burn up to 50% more calories compared to flat workouts.
Q4: Are there particular workouts recommended for incline treadmill users? Definitely! Incorporating interval training, hill sprints, or endurance runs at differing inclines can take full advantage of the benefits and keep exercises interesting and challenging.
Q5: How typically should I utilize the incline function? This largely depends on your fitness objectives. For beginners, beginning with a couple of incline workouts per week is suggested. As you advance, gradually increase the frequency and intensity of your incline sessions.
6. Security Features and Considerations While electric incline treadmills boast many advantages, it is vital to keep safety in mind. When utilizing a treadmill with an incline function, think about the following:
Start Slow: If you're new to incline workouts, start with a progressive incline before advancing to steeper angles. Proper Footwear: Ensure you have appropriate running shoes to supply assistance and decrease the chance of injury. Stay Hydrated: Keep water accessible, specifically throughout intensive incline exercises. Use the Handrails: If you're uncertain or putting in oneself at steep inclines, use the handrails for balance.
